Subject: Idempotency keys for payment retries — Bramblepay 4.2

Team, this release enforces idempotency keys on all payment retry paths. Contractors: never generate a fresh key on retry; reuse the original, or Bramblepay will double-charge in edge cases under gateway timeouts. Staging has a duplicate-detection dashboard — verify zero duplicates before approving. The release is tagged with the token below.

session token of tajef-bageg = htk21_5d90d574934f3ccae6437

Hello plugin authors,

Next Thursday, Corbexa will run a disaster-recovery drill for the RestockRoute vending-machine restock planner. During the failover window, plugin callbacks will be replayed against the standby scheduler, so please ensure your handlers are idempotent and tolerate duplicate route assignments. No customer restock data will be altered. To re-register your plugin against the standby environment during the drill, authenticate with the recovery passphrase provided below.

vault phrase of hahip-tajeg = quenax-briath-briax

TICKET #—74: Missed Pick-Up, Safe Replacement Lock

The replacement lock assembly for the Hartwell Room safe was not collected yesterday; the Bellgrave Secure courier arrived after the office closed. The lock is still in its sealed case in the key cabinet, and the locksmith at Ostram & Vane needs it before Thursday to finish the rebuild. A new pick-up is booked for tomorrow between 9 and 11. Please have the case ready at reception and the transfer form signed in advance.

handover note for tadug-yaguf: the aldath pelwyn courier leaves the casox norwyn briix silok zorok kasdor aldion quenox ledger at gate 2653 under passcode 959015